I just completed assembling sn 976 and am now attempting to set my K3 up. One area I would appreciate some assistance on is the settings for a Heil PR 781 microphone. I have played around with mike gain, cmp, alc and transmit eq settings but it is difficult to really know how you sound with just the monitor circuit. If anyone can give me a starting point for this mike I would appreciate it. I like to chase DX so I am looking for settings which will give some "punch". I would also like to know if anyone has played around with the CONFIG:TXG VCE menu which is suppose to adjust voice transmit gain balance. 73, Richard N4WDU

For what it may be worth, I have used +1.0 and +1.5 on the CONFIG:TXG VCE
menu. +1.5 is a bit high but +1.0 seems about right to me. With an indicated CW power out of 1 KW, I read about 1.5 KW PEP on a Coaxial Dynamics peak reading watt meter with CONFIG:TXG VCE at +1. I don't think it is wise to go any higher with it.
